## Changelog — Font vendoring defaults changed

As of this release, the Bracken UI build no longer fetches third-party fonts at build time. All typefaces used by the Lanternwell suite are now vendored into the repo under a dedicated assets directory, and the fetch step is skipped by default. If you're onboarding, nothing to install — the fonts travel with the checkout. The build flags controlling this behavior are listed below.

settings of hadup-yafog:
LAMAEL_PIN=3761
LAMAEL_TENANT=istmir
LAMAEL_METRICS_HOST=metrics.lamael.plorvasys.test
LAMAEL_SEAL=seal_8ea68500
LAMAEL_STANDBY_TEAM=fraok

## Pixlet CLI: Limits & Quotas

Hey plugin authors — before you fire off a 10k-image batch through `pixlet resize`, know that the CLI enforces quotas so one plugin can't starve everyone else. Concurrency, per-run image counts, and output dimensions are all capped, and exceeding them returns a soft error your plugin should handle gracefully. Most limits are generous; if you hit one regularly, that's usually a sign to chunk your batches. The current defaults are shown here.

tuning table, kajog-kawef:
PRIORITIES = {
    "kelox": 870,
    "kasix": 89,
    "eliax": 988,
}

Hey future maintainer! The Pellbright profile store is sharded by region prefix — see shard-map.toml before touching routing. Resharding jobs run from the Owlferry box and must be signed, or the migrator refuses to start. You'll want the deploy key for that box in your agent; it's pasted right below.

release key, fajef-kajeg: bky19_LdLu6Ne6FLi8he2c24d

## Releases

ChipGate is the firmware and reader service for the Larkspur Marathon timing mats. We cut a release at the end of each race season and tag it from the main branch. Builds are produced by the Foxtail CI pipeline and pushed to the internal artifact mirror. Every firmware image must be verified before it is flashed to a reader unit. Verify downloaded images against the release signing key below.

signing key of bagap-yawep = bky13_TbfT6ZMUoGJo2